Building Foundational Networking Knowledge

Networking is the backbone of IT systems, connecting users, devices, and applications across diverse environments. For beginners, understanding core networking concepts such as IP addressing, routing, subnetting, and protocols is essential. This foundational knowledge helps professionals troubleshoot connectivity issues, optimize performance, and secure communications. IT certifications often introduce these concepts through practical scenarios, ensuring learners can apply theory to real-world situations. Networking skills also complement cloud and cybersecurity training, as cloud deployments rely heavily on virtual networks and secure communication channels. By mastering basic networking principles early, entry-level professionals develop confidence in navigating complex environments and understanding how systems interconnect. The practical exercises included in many certifications, such as configuring routers, managing firewalls, or analyzing traffic patterns, reinforce both conceptual and applied understanding. These competencies not only improve employability but also create a strong base for advanced studies in cloud architecture, DevOps, and IT infrastructure management. Beginners who invest in networking knowledge often experience faster onboarding in professional roles and are better equipped to collaborate with technical teams, ensuring smoother project execution and more effective problem-solving. A solid grasp of networking principles empowers IT professionals to see the bigger picture of how systems operate together.

Introduction To Cybersecurity Essentials

Cybersecurity has become a critical component of every IT professional’s skill set due to the increasing prevalence of cyber threats and regulatory requirements. Understanding basic security principles helps beginners protect systems, applications, and data from potential attacks. IT certifications often cover areas such as authentication, encryption, firewalls, malware prevention, and access control, emphasizing practical strategies for maintaining system integrity. These skills are valuable across all IT roles, whether managing networks, developing software, or deploying cloud solutions. For entry-level professionals, learning cybersecurity fundamentals early provides a safety-first mindset, allowing them to design and manage secure environments while adhering to organizational policies. Real-world exercises, such as configuring secure connections or identifying vulnerabilities, reinforce theoretical knowledge and build confidence. Additionally, familiarity with security standards and compliance requirements prepares learners for increasingly complex projects where privacy and data protection are priorities. Cybersecurity knowledge also intersects with cloud and project management skills, creating a more holistic understanding of IT operations. Professionals who integrate security awareness into their daily work demonstrate responsibility and foresight, which are highly valued by employers. Early exposure to these practices establishes a strong foundation for pursuing specialized certifications and advanced security roles.

Understanding Automation And Scripting Basics

Automation is a key driver of efficiency in modern IT environments, reducing repetitive tasks and minimizing human error. For beginners, gaining familiarity with scripting languages and automation tools provides a competitive advantage by enabling them to manage tasks systematically. Common scripting languages include Python, Bash, and PowerShell, which allow users to automate system configurations, data processing, and cloud deployments. Learning the basics of these languages through entry-level certifications helps professionals develop logical thinking, troubleshoot scripts, and understand workflow automation. Automation also intersects with cloud and network management, as tasks such as server provisioning, backup scheduling, and performance monitoring benefit from repeatable scripts. Early exposure to automation teaches beginners how to analyze processes, identify opportunities for efficiency, and implement solutions effectively. Beyond technical skills, understanding automation fosters a mindset that values continuous improvement and proactive problem-solving. Professionals who can design scripts or leverage automation tools contribute to faster deployment cycles and more reliable operations, making them valuable assets to their teams. Mastering automation fundamentals sets the stage for more advanced topics such as DevOps pipelines, infrastructure-as-code, and continuous integration/continuous deployment strategies.
